Is Truly Cruelty-Free?

Truly is cruelty-free. The brand has confirmed their cruelty-free status with CFK. They don't test finished products or ingredients on animals, and neither do their suppliers or any third-parties. We've also verified that their products are not tested on animals anywhere in the world, including mainland China.

Is Truly owned by a parent company that tests on animals?

Truly is not owned by any parent company that tests on animals.

Is Truly sold where animal testing is required by law?

No, Truly is not sold where animal testing is required by law.

Is Truly certified cruelty-free by any organizations?

Yes, Truly is certified by Leaping Bunny.

Is Truly vegan?

Truly is cruelty-free but not 100% vegan, meaning that some of their products contain animal-derived ingredients.

How do you determine that brands like Truly are cruelty-free?

We contact brands directly with our questions in order to get their full animal testing policy. If brands answer all our questions and confirm that no animal testing is happening at any point during production and beyond, they're added to our cruelty-free list. All brands we add have confirmed the information above.
